It is comprised of the <a href=\"https:\/\/mom-ocean.github.io\/\">MOM5.1<\/a> ocean model coupled to the <a href=\"https:\/\/github.com\/CICE-Consortium\/CICE-svn-trunk\/tree\/cice-5.1.2\">CICE5.1.2<\/a> sea ice model via OASIS3-MCT.<\/p>\n<p>The model is global, extending from the North Pole to the Antarctic ice shelf edge. The model lateral resolution is 0.25\u00b0 at the Equator, with a tripolar grid north of 65\u00b0N and Mercator projection between 65\u00b0N and 65\u00b0S, with uniform meridional spacing from 65\u00b0S to the Antarctic ice shelf edge. It has 50 vertical levels. The model is configured to run with the JRA55-do forcing dataset.<\/p>\n<p>Further details on version 1.0 of the model are available in <a href=\"https:\/\/doi.org\/10.5194\/gmd-13-401-2020\">Kiss et al. (2020)<\/a>.
